YUI Theater — Luke Smith: “Debugging in YUI 3″
November 10, 2009 at 5:28 pm by Eric Miraglia | In Development, YUI Theater | No CommentsIn Luke’s (@ls_n’s)second session at YUICONF 2009 (the first, “Events Evolved,” is also available on video), he addressed common challenges in debugging JavaScript — and some of the tools and techniques unique to doing so in YUI 3-based applications.
